Actor Franco Interlenghi, who
made his debut in De Sica's Sciuscia' at the age of 15 before
going on to appear in other classic films by Fellini and
Antonioni, has died in his Rome home at the age of 83, his
family said Thursday.
Interlenghi made memorable appearances in Fellini's I
Vitelloni and Antonioni's I Vinti and also worked with Luchino
Visconti in his stage adaptation of Death of a Salesman.
Married to Antonella Lualdi, he had a daughter,
Antonellina Interlenghi, who is an actress as well.
